Wow! What a day!
I received an email from USA Today Pop Candy Blog Editor Whitney Matheson today. "This is so great," she said of the "Mister Rogers & Me" link I sent her last week. "I just wrote about it. Good luck, and please keep me posted!
I clicked on over to her blog and read her piece, How many lives were changed by Mister Rogers?
I got goosebumps! Then I emailed my brother, called my wife, and emailed Whitney.
"Wow, Whitney. Thank you so much! I have goose bumps. We've been
quietly, diligently and (often) frustratingly plugging away at this
little indie for years. Sometimes it feels like an albatross, like an
impossibly difficult assignment from Mister Rogers himself (I mean, what
do you tell America's Favorite Neighbor when he asks you to "Spread the
message"!?!). So to have it see the light of day for real is really
exciting. I REALLY appreciate it, Whitney, and will absolutely keep you
posted."
Pretty cool.
Thanks, Whitney!

Christofer and Benjamin Wagner have been making films together since their 1981 Super8mm remake of "The Greatest American Hero."
Christofer is currently Senior Editor, Creative Group. Benjamin is Vice President, MTV News.
